The Concept Behind Cross-Chain Tokenization
Tokenization involves converting tangible or intangible assets into digital tokens that can be easily transferred and traded on a blockchain. This process has revolutionized asset management by making previously illiquid assets accessible to a broader market. Cross-chain tokenization takes this concept further by enabling tokens to function seamlessly across different blockchain networks, effectively dissolving the rigid boundaries that have long confined digital assets.
Technically, cross-chain tokenization leverages a blend of cryptographic protocols, smart contracts, and emerging interoperability standards to securely transfer tokens between blockchains. For example, a token created on one network can be “wrapped” and represented on another, allowing it to tap into ecosystems that offer lower transaction fees, faster confirmation times, or distinct decentralized finance (DeFi) opportunities. This multi-chain functionality not only increases liquidity but also opens up new avenues for value creation and market participation.
This approach is also highly adaptive. Developers can integrate the most compelling features from various blockchains—be it speed, security, or scalability—into a single hybrid solution. Such integration encourages a modular development paradigm, where applications are built with flexibility in mind. Users gain the freedom to choose the network that best suits their needs at any given moment, a benefit that ultimately fosters a more competitive and user-driven digital marketplace.

Challenges and How They Are Addressed
Despite the transformative potential of cross-chain tokenization, several challenges must be overcome to ensure its widespread adoption. Security is a primary concern; transferring tokens across multiple networks introduces additional points of vulnerability. Hackers may target the bridges connecting blockchains, making it essential to implement robust security measures. Developers are countering these risks with advanced cryptographic techniques, multi-signature protocols, and decentralized verification processes that collectively safeguard transactions.
Standardization of interoperability protocols presents another significant challenge. With each blockchain operating under its own set of rules, establishing a universal framework for cross-chain transactions is complex. Collaborative efforts among industry leaders and innovative startups are underway to develop these universal standards, aiming to create a seamless and secure environment for token transfers. As these standards mature, the process of integrating disparate systems will become increasingly straightforward.

Deep Dive into Technical Protocols
A critical enabler of cross-chain tokenization is the development of robust technical protocols designed to facilitate secure, efficient interactions between diverse blockchain networks. Projects like Polkadot and Cosmos have pioneered frameworks that connect previously isolated chains, using relay chains and hub-and-spoke models to harmonize different protocols. These systems rely on smart contracts and standardized communication protocols to manage token transfers with precision and reliability.
Polkadot, for example, employs a unique relay chain to coordinate the activities of various blockchains, ensuring that data and value are transferred securely across the network. Cosmos has introduced the Inter-Blockchain Communication (IBC) protocol, which offers a standardized method for exchanging data and assets between chains. Both protocols exemplify how technical ingenuity can dismantle the barriers imposed by blockchain silos.

Security Considerations and Best Practices
Security is paramount in any discussion of cross-chain tokenization, as the involvement of multiple blockchain networks increases the complexity of the threat landscape. To mitigate risks, developers adopt a multi-layered security approach that includes the use of multi-signature wallets, decentralized oracles, and advanced cryptographic algorithms. These measures ensure that even if one component is compromised, the integrity of the overall system remains intact.
Multi-signature protocols, for example, require several independent approvals before a transaction is executed, thereby reducing the risk of unauthorized access. Decentralized oracles play a crucial role by providing tamper-resistant external data to smart contracts, ensuring that the information driving token transfers is both accurate and secure.
